Disconnecting the battery during clutch service is important to prevent electrical damage or injury. When working on the clutch system, there is a risk of short circuits if the electrical system is not disconnected. This precaution also ensures that the clutch system can be serviced safely without any electrical interference. It is a standard safety practice recommended by manufacturers and professional mechanics.

How do you replace clutch on 1994 gmc sonoma 2.2?

To Remove: 1. Remove or disconnect the following: Transmission Quick disconnect from the slave cylinder 2. Install a clutch alignment tool. 3. Mark the flywheel and a clutch pressure plate lug for the installation alignment if reusing the pressure plate. 4. Remove or disconnect the following: Pressure plate bolts and the washers 5. Secure the clutch pressure plate and the clutch driven plate to the flywheel. 5. Remove the clutch alignment tool. To install: 1. Install or connect the following: Bolts and the washers securing the clutch pressure plate and the clutch driven plate to the flywheel Clutch alignment tool 2. Install the pressure plate. Align the marks made during removal if reusing the pressure plate. Tighten the clutch pressure plate mounting bolts. Torque to: 30 ft. lbs. (40 Nm) on the NV3500 or 33 ft. lbs. (44 Nm) on the NV1500 3. Remove the clutch alignment tool. 4. Install or connect the following: Manual Transmission, Quick disconnect to the concentric slave cylinder 5. Bleed the clutch hydraulic system if necessary. 6. Test drive the vehicle to confirm the repairs.

What does the H and S stand for in HS Battery 3rd Gun Battalion 38th Artillery?

What Country and Time period?? Assuming this is US during WW2, then the "HS Battery" is probably "HQ Battery". The typical Field Artillery Battalion contained three firing batteries named "Battery A", "Battery B" and "Battery C" and a smaller service battery called "Service Battery". The Commander, his staff and clerical assistants were part of the "Headquarters Battery" or "HQ Battery". If your question relates to a different country or period, then the HQ Battery and Service Battery may be combined and called "H&S Battery" but I'm not sure of that.

How do you change a starter on a 1993 camaro v6 34 motor?

disconnect battery. from underneath disconnect solenoid wire and battery cable from starter solenoid. remove starter motor bolts. remove starter motor. installation is the reverse but be sure to place the starter shim between the starter motor and the engine or you will get noise during starts.
